James Reeve (Quinneys of Warwick) has dated this piece to the Regency era.
There is lovely black line Greek key inlay detail on the top and the front and back.

It has been through our workshop and is in excellent robust condition. There are a few old repairs but they are all sound. The top has the original finish and is slightly faded but it's a uniform colour and looks good.
The pedestal is wonderful and has 4 outswept reeded legs that terminate in hairy feet casters.
A great piece
The measurements below are with the flaps down. With the flaps up the width is 153cm
